Applied AI & Intelligent Document Processing

Custom Deep Learning OCR for Handwritten Historical Scans

Bespoke optical character recognition models trained specifically for unstructured, complex handwritten documents where commercial OCRs failed.

Timeline: April 2024 – October 2025
Delivery: Production-Ready

The Business & Technical Challenge

Off-the-shelf OCR engines (AWS Textract, Tesseract, Google Vision) failed to accurately decipher handwritten cursive logs and tabular marginalia.

The Engineered Architecture & Solution

Trained and fine-tuned custom vision models with specialized image binarization, stroke enhancement, and human-pattern parsing logic.

Measured Business Outcome & Impact

Surpassed industry standard commercial OCR accuracy by 35% on complex handwritten historical records.
